Facebook announced the launch of a new feature called "Today in", which will feed local news and information to users.

Initially,  this new feature is being tested in six cities - New Orleans, Louisiana; Little Rock, Arkansas; Billings, Montana; Peoria, Illinois; Olympia, Washington and Binghamton, New York. This idea is from the company's new partnership team which is managed by NBC news anchor Campbell Brown and a part of Facebook's Journalism project.

Users who will identify themselves to be living in that area will be able to view the local news. Facebook is trying hands on a machine-learning software which will surface content in Today.in. The idea behind the new feature is that users worldwide can see the local news and events from cities they don't live in.

In November, Facebook renamed its event app to Facebook Local. This app will be completely different from the new local news section.

Facebook is emphasizing on local news publishers to deal with the fake news problem, by offering information through verified sources only.

The  Founder and CEO of Facebook  Mark Zuckerberg said that it is his personal New Year Resolution  to “fix Facebook” in 2018, including the recruitment of experts to look at “questions of history, civics, political philosophy, media, government, and of course technology".
